I've made a tiny avi and set of animations for itself...I tried to include the anims with franimation ao inside the tiny but for some odd reason my avatar keeps unfolding itself after playing certain animations...can anyone recommend another ao script that would work better with folded avs?

It might be that you haven't set the animation priority high enough. When you upload the anim, there's a box to set priority from 1-4 (or is it 0 to 4?).

No idea which AO script you are using, but you could play around with ZHAO. It has the advantage of being free and readily available, but I've no idea on how well it scores on keeping you folded. Make sure that all the slots for 'stand' animations are filled, or it will cycle to default ones, which will unfold your av.

I have a (fairly expensive) commercial animal av from a respected builder, but even that unfolds, often after a TP. Toggling the AO off & on works, but it's a hassle.
